Abstract
The utility model discloses a pressing-down overload protection device for a straightener and solves the problem that the straightening force of a conventional straightener can not be conveniently adjusted. The pressing-down overload protection device comprises an overturned-barrel-shaped frame (3) which is in sleeve connection with a rotary hub (2). A through hole and a straightening force bearing (7) are arranged on the center of the top plate of the overturned-barrel-shaped frame (3). One end of an adjusting leading screw (12) arranged in the rotary hub (2) sequentially passes through the straightening force bearing (7), and a balancing bearing assembly (10) and a circular nut (9) arranged on the center of the top surface of the top plate of the overturned-barrel-shaped frame (3) and connects with a handwheel (8). A copper nut (4) is arranged no the adjusting leading screw (12) in the rotary hub (2), and a straightening force adjusting pad (15) is arranged on the top surface of the copper nut (4). A bellevill spring (17) is arranged between the bottom of the copper nut (4) and the bottom of the inner cavity of the rotary hub (2), and the bottom of the rotary hub (2) is in press connection with a straightening roller device (1). The pressing-down overload protection device is simple in structure, easy for installation, and flexible in adjusting.

Background technology
Bar and seamless steel pipe are being rolled, in the production process that cooling etc. is various, are often being occured bending and deformation because of reasons such as motive power and variations in temperature.Thereby in its production process, all need straightener that it is aligned.In the aligning process,, and to damage equipment such as smoothing roll and rectified workpiece because workpiece outside diameter tolerance straightening force excessive or that degree of crook too seriously causes is excessive in order preventing, straightener all is furnished with the overload protection arrangement of depressing.The existing overload protection arrangement of depressing often uses hydraulic pressure to depress overload protection arrangement.But hydraulic pressure is depressed bar and the seamless steel pipe of overload protection arrangement for minor diameter, because the straightener unit is little, uses hydraulic protecting, and unit is difficult to assembling, and difficult in maintenance, manufacture difficulty is big.The protection of the use butterfly spring that also has, but exist unit after installing, can not adjust the problem of the maximum straightening force that unit bears flexibly.

Changeing hub 2 is placed in the barrel-shaped frame 3 of back-off; And changeing hub 2 can slide in the barrel-shaped frame 3 of back-off freely; Pressing plate 6 is pressed in butterfly spring 17, copper nut 4 and straightening force adjusting pad 15 successively in order to be changeed in the hub 2, and pressing plate 6 usefulness screws 5 are fixed on to be changeed on the hub 2, and the pad 16 and a nut 14 usefulness adjustment screw 13 that disappears were installed on the copper nut 4 between screw thread disappeared; The thickness of pad 16 was adjusted the screw thread pair gap between the adjustment screw thread disappeared; Make the unit adjustment accurately, adjustment leading screw 12 is installed on the barrel-shaped frame 3 of back-off through straightening force bearing 7, equalizer bearing assembly 10 and round nut 9, and the end of thread and the nut 14 that disappears, the copper nut 4 of adjustment leading screw 12 couple together; Handwheel 8 is installed in the afterbody of adjustment leading screw 12, drives adjustment leading screw 12 and carries out the adjustment of drafts.When the aligning workpiece; Straightening roller device receives straightening force, through changeing hub 2, butterfly spring 17, copper nut 4, adjustment leading screw 12 and straightening force bearing 7 straightening force passed on the frame successively, and when straightening force during greater than the prestressing force of butterfly spring 17; Butterfly spring 17 is compressed; Change hub 2 and bounce back together with straightening roller device, play the effect of protection workpiece, the thickness that also can adjust straightening force adjusting pad 15 is adjusted the prestressing force of butterfly spring 17; Thereby the maximum straightening force that the adjustment unit can bear, the effect of playing the protection unit and being aligned workpiece.
The overload protection arrangement of depressing of the present invention is when rectifying the workpiece that the workpiece outside diameter tolerance is excessive or degree of crook is serious; Surpass setting like straightening force; The butterfly spring of screwdown gear is compressed, and changes hub and straightening roller device and withdraws with screwdown gear, and the quilt that plays protection is rectified the effect of workpiece.Also can adjust the maximum straightening force that unit can bear, play protective effect unit according to theory and practice.In unit manufacturing and when assembling and since had screw thread disappear between pad, reduced greatly and made and the difficulty of assembling, make device fabrication simple, easy for installation.
